Water aerobics and water treatment minimize joint as well as muscle mass pain and encourage adaptability as well as physical motion. The typical price of room resemble decrease is $1,000 to $2,500. This task consists of improving floorings, ceilings, and walls to moisten resemble and reduce interior sound that makes it tougher to listen to as well as interact for those with hearing problems. Carpets is a wonderful method to wet echo, along with acoustic foam and also paneling for the walls as well as ceiling.

The two-wall shower uses heavy shower curtains and a retractable water retainer along the threshold of the floor to maintain water in the shower and the restroom floors completely dry. When the mobility device rolls over the water retainer, it collapses down and then pops back up into location. Due to the tiny room, we selected a roll-in two-wall shower.

Next, we replaced the previous vanity sink with a wall surface hung sink for better use with a mobility device as well as moved it beside the shower. Wall hung sinks are a fantastic replacement for vanities and even pedestal sinks due to the fact that they allow the individual to roll up and under the sink and obtain closer to the basin. The new sink likewise replaced the older handles with a Gooseneck Faucet and also Winged Deals With. This is a fantastic different to the handles because the takes care of can be pressed or drawn as opposed to turning, making them much easier to use. The handles can be run with the hand of the hand and also the goose neck spout added a greater clearance than the previous spout for cleansing urine bottles.
